Purnapragna: With a change of MUDA commissioner again, the ring road project looks to be headed in a worse-case situation for the school. Current plan is to rebuild Mrs. Tara's residence cum school on the same side of the ring road as that of the rest of the school buildings. A fence will be built between the school and the road. Event though this will lead to a severe shortage of play/activity area in the school premises, this will allow Mrs. Tara to have live near the school.
